Princess Auguste Viktoria Friederike Luise Feodora Jenny of Schleswig-Holstein-Sonderburg Augustenburg (October 22, 1858 - April 11, 1921) was the last German Empress and Queen of Prussia. On February 27, 1881, Augusta married the then Prince William of Purssia. Empress Augusta gave birth to seven children by William. Crown Prince Wilhelm (1882-1951), Prince Eitel Friedrich (1883-1942), Prince Adalbert (1884-1948), Prince August Wilhelm (1887-1949), Princc Oskar (1888-1958), Prince Joachim (1890-1920) and Princess Viktoria (1892-1980). "Dona", as Augusta was nicknamed accompanied William to the Netherlands after World War I and died in House Doorn in Dooorn in 1921. The Weimar Republic allowed her remains to be returned to Germany and she is buried in the Temple of Antiquities not far from the New Palace, Potsdam.
